AP Art History 250 Required Images. 250 terms ...Start studying Ap Art History 250 Flashcards. Learn vocabulary, terms, and more with flashcards.Form: -terra cotta with dentate stamping method. Function: -unknown, but could be for ancestors or ritualistic/religious use. Content: -dentate designs (circles, hatching, dots) -Patterns=family lineage. Context: -Lapita peoples. -created by artisans in Lapita culture (Pacific) -explored ocean and lived on coast. 12.Study with Quizlet and memorize flashcards containing terms like Apollo 11, paleolithic era, charcoal on rock, Namibia (charcoal on rock depicts a dog in profile. Form: -Tenebrism now used in secular aspects (mimicking Caravaggio) -Chiaroscuro: contrast between light and dark. Content: -orrery: model of the solar system (heliocentric) -philosopher explain something to people in painting (education is sacred) Function: -introduction to science. Paleolithic Europe. …The AP Art History is equivalent to a two-trimester introductory college course that explores the nature of art, art making, and responses to art.
